Getting Started with Bluey Nail Art: DIY Tips
If you're feeling crafty, painting your own Bluey nails can be incredibly rewarding. I usually start with a good base coat – blue and orange are obviously classic choices, but don't shy away from pastels or even pinks for a fun twist! For characters like Bluey and Bingo, tiny brushes are your best friend. I find that painting the main shape first, then adding details like their eyes and noses, works best. Don't worry if it's not perfect; the charm is in the effort! You can also use dotting tools for perfect paw prints or small circles. And glitter? Always a good idea for that extra sparkle, especially if you're going for a vibrant colors look!

Keeping Your Bluey Nails Looking Fresh
No matter if you've gone DIY or opted for press-ons, proper care helps your Bluey nails last longer. For painted nails, a good quality top coat is essential to prevent chipping and add shine. I always reapply mine every couple of days. For press-ons, make sure your natural nails are clean and dry before application, and avoid prolonged exposure to water if possible. If a press-on starts to lift, a tiny dab of nail glue can usually save the day. With a little care, your adorable Bluey nail art will stay looking fantastic, ready for all your adventures!
